Arcane MCP Server

Delete volume backup

arcane_volume_backup_delete
Destructive

Permanently delete a volume backup by specifying environment, volume name, and backup ID. Use with caution as this action is irreversible.

Instructions

[HIGH RISK] Delete a volume backup permanently

Input Schema

TableJSON Schema
NameRequiredDescriptionDefault
environmentIdYesEnvironment ID
volumeNameYesVolume name
backupIdYesBackup ID to delete
